  • Deposit Insurance Corporation (LPS), is an independent agency, which serves depositor guarantee deposits and actively participates in maintaining the stability of the banking system in accordance with their authority. In carrying out these functions, LPS has the task, among others: (1) formulate and determine policy implementation ofdeposit insurance, (2) implement deposit insurance, (3) formulate and determine policy in order to actively maintain the stability ofthe banking system, (4) formulate, define, and implement Bank settlement policy that does not affect systemic failure, and (5) implement the handling ofBank Failure systemic impact. In theframework oflegal protection ofdepositors under the Act LPS, LPS not really get the protection of the law, particularly in relation to public law between LPS with depositors. LPS is not known in Islamic law, but is known to an agency that has one function as LPS is Baitul Mal wat Tamwil (BMT), which has been known in the economic traffic ofIslam since the time ofthe Prophet. BMTposition ofIslamic law, are: First, a public law institution which is engaged in the general field, not individually. Baitul Mal not only handles most aspects ~feconomic activity ~f the people, but an agency in charge ~f all the inflows and ou(flows ~f the Islamic government (caliphate). Second, part ~f the state institutions in charge ~ffinance income and expenses.
